Sequencing is an important tool for teaching yoga. The more confident yoga teachers can move within the structure of the class, the more energy is free for spontaneity and genuine connection.
Nicole Bongartz provides the key principles and the necessary knowledge for this, so that all those who have worked with this book have the freedom, creativity and sufficient background knowledge to design intelligent and varied practice sequences for their yoga classes. In addition to a broad theoretical background, it offers numerous graphics with examples for sequencing on various topics, worksheets for practising on your own and concrete practical tips.
